Troubleshooting & Replacement Tips
After ten years of field work on rotating machinery protection systems, here is what actually goes wrong with 3300 NSv probes — and what to watch before you button everything back up.
Fault Code: Not OK (NOK) LED on Proximitor
This is the most common call I get. Before condemning the probe, check the gap voltage at the proximitor output. If you read a voltage outside the −10 VDC to −18 VDC window (for a 2 mm nominal gap on 4140 steel), the probe is either gapped wrong or the cable is open. Disconnect the extension cable at the proximitor and measure continuity on the probe + integral cable assembly. An open circuit confirms probe failure — order the 330903-00-17-05-02-00 and move on.
Cable Length Mismatch — The Silent Killer
The 3300 NSv system is calibrated as a matched set: probe integral cable + extension cable = total system length. The 330903-00-17-05-02-00 carries a 0.5 m integral cable (suffix -17). If your existing extension cable was calibrated for a probe with a different integral length, your scale factor will be off. Pull the calibration data plate off the proximitor and confirm the total cable length before installing. A 5% scale factor error on a 100 mil range probe means 5 mil of false reading — enough to mask a real bearing problem.
Target Material Correction
Standard calibration is AISI 4140 steel. If your shaft is 17-4 PH stainless, Inconel, or titanium, the eddy-current response curve shifts. Do not assume the reading is accurate. Either apply the published correction factor from the Bently Nevada calibration manual or request a field recalibration. Skipping this step on a compressor with tight clearances is how you miss a developing rub.
Replacement Procedure (Field-Verified Steps)
- De-energize the proximitor supply (−24 VDC). Do not hot-swap — transient voltages can damage the oscillator circuit.
- Loosen the probe locknut and back the probe out. Count the turns — this gives you a reference for re-gapping.
- Install the 330903-00-17-05-02-00. Thread in until probe tip is approximately 1.0 mm from shaft surface (starting point).
- Re-energize and monitor gap voltage. Adjust probe depth until output reads −10.5 VDC to −11.5 VDC (approximately 1.0 mm gap on 4140 steel at 7.87 V/mm scale factor).
- Torque locknut to specification. Re-verify gap voltage after torquing — probe can shift slightly.
- Confirm OK status on monitor. Log the as-left gap voltage in your maintenance record.
Common Alarm Codes After Replacement
If the monitor shows Danger High immediately after installation, the probe is likely gapped too close (gap voltage too high in absolute terms, shaft appears to be vibrating at maximum). If it shows Danger Low or Not OK, the probe is too far from the shaft or the cable connection is intermittent. Check the BNC connector seating at both ends before pulling the probe again.
Reliability in Harsh Conditions
The 330903-00-17-05-02-00 is not a lab instrument. It lives in bearing pedestals, compressor casings, and turbine enclosures where ambient temperatures swing from cold startup to sustained 150 °C+ operation, where lube oil mist coats every surface, and where the machine itself generates continuous broadband vibration across the probe mounting structure.
The 316 stainless steel housing resists H₂S, steam condensate, and process fluid ingress that would corrode a lesser housing within months. The IP67 rating on the probe body means it survives wash-down and incidental fluid immersion without compromising the coil assembly inside. The M10 × 1 thread is a coarse-pitch design that resists vibration-induced loosening — but always use the locknut and verify torque. A probe that backs out 0.2 mm under vibration will generate a false high-vibration alarm that shuts down your machine at 3 AM.
Operating temperature ceiling of 177 °C on the probe body covers the vast majority of steam turbine bearing pedestal environments. For applications exceeding this — hot-section gas turbine proximity measurements — consult the extended-temperature probe variants. Do not push this probe beyond its rated envelope and expect the calibration to hold.
Vibration resistance of the probe assembly itself is validated to the levels specified in API 670 Annex D. The integral cable strain relief is the most mechanically stressed point in the assembly; inspect it during every planned outage for cracking or chafing. A fractured cable at the strain relief produces an intermittent open circuit that is extremely difficult to diagnose remotely — it shows up as random NOK trips that clear when the machine is at rest.
